Hur installerar jag den senaste versionen av Python på Ubuntu och Debian?

Hur installerar jag den senaste versionen av Python på Ubuntu och Debian?

Hur installerar jag den senaste versionen av Python på Ubuntu och Debian?

Eftersom det redan är välkänt av många tekniska användare av fria och öppna operativsystem baserade på GNU/Linux, dvs. Linux-distributioner som Ubuntu, Debian, Arch, Red Hat, SUSE och många fler; nästan alla kommer som standard med någon icke-ny och stabil version av Python installerad. Och naturligtvis representerar detta ofta inte några problem eller begränsningar för en kontorsanvändare eller administrativ användare hemma, i skolan eller på kontoret.

Men för medelstora eller avancerade tekniska användare, såsom utvecklare, system- och serveradministratörer, eller självlärd teknisk nyfikenhet i kontinuerlig testning och experimenterande av applikationer och system, kan detta representera vissa problem och begränsningar. Och även om många gånger, Vissa GNU/Linux Distros kommer med andra, lite mer aktuella versioner av Python i sina arkiv. som är installerade som standard erbjuder de nästan aldrig den senaste stabila versionen och ännu mindre, en i utvecklingsfasen. Därför, om någon behöver använda några av dessa tidigare nämnda versioner, måste de tillgripa alternativa metoder. Och av denna anledning kommer vi idag kort att visa dig stegen att följa i två alternativa metoder för att uppnå detta mål. Det vill säga att veta hur «installera den senaste versionen av Python på Ubuntu och Debian », eller andra derivat av dessa.

om installation av python 3.9

Men innan du börjar denna publikation med denna användbara och intressanta handledning att uppnå «installera den senaste versionen av Python på Ubuntu och Debian », rekommenderar vi att du utforskar en tidigare relaterat inlägg Med ämnet Python, i slutet av att läsa detta:

om installation av python 3.9
Relaterad artikel:
Python 3.9, hur man installerar den här versionen på Ubuntu 20.04

Handledning för att installera Python på Ubuntu och Debian: Alternativa metoder

Handledning för att installera Python på Ubuntu och Debian: Alternativa metoder

Metoder för att installera den senaste versionen av Python i Ubuntu och Debian

Installation via Deadsnakes PPA Repository

El Team Deadsnakes PPA Repository har under lång tid visat sig vara en pålitlig leverantör av paket av olika python-versioner till ubuntu, Debian och Distros härledda från dem. Och för att använda den och installera vissa versioner av Python, är stegen att följa för närvarande som följer:

  • Öppna en terminalemulator på Ubuntu eller Derived
  • Kör följande kommandoorder:
sudo add-apt-repository ppa:deadsnakes/ppa
sudo apt-get update
sudo apt-get install python3.13

Om det behövs kan du också installera en fullständig version genom att ersätta den senaste kommandoordningen med följande:

sudo apt-get install python3.13-full

Medan, om en Debian Distro eller derivat av den används, kommer det ytterligare att göra redigera filen "sources.list". krävs med följande kommando:

sudo nano /etc/apt/sources.list.d/deadsnakes-ubuntu-ppa-$VersionDebianDetectada.list

Ändra sedan ordet "bullseye" eller "bokmask" eller något annat ord som motsvarar Debian och derivator med orden "jammy" eller "focal" som motsvarar Ubuntu. Och skaffa på så sätt följande förvarsrad (mjukvarukälla) som ett resultat:

deb https://ppa.launchpadcontent.net/deadsnakes/ppa/ubuntu/ jammy main

Och så, fortsätt med att uppdatera paketlistan igen och installera python version 3, vilket behövdes.

Installation via Python-kompilering från det officiella arkivet

Installation via Python-kompilering från det officiella arkivet

Detta är vanligtvis en lite mer komplex och längre rutt, men också säkrare och mer pålitlig, eftersom det är bokstavligen ladda ner Python-källfiler från det officiella arkivet för sammanställning direkt från vår dator. Och att använda det och lyckas installera vissa versioner av Python, stegen att följa för närvarande är följande:

Tidigare steg: installation av viktiga paket och bibliotek
sudo apt install wget build-essential
sudo apt-get install libreadline-gplv2-dev libncursesw5-dev libssl-dev libsqlite3-dev tk-dev libgdbm-dev libc6-dev libbz2-dev libffi-dev zlib1g-dev
Huvudsteg: Python-kompilering
cd /tmp/
wget https://www.python.org/ftp/python/3.13.0/Python-3.13.0a3.tar.xz
tar -xf Python-3.13.0a3.tar.xz
cd Python-3.13.0a3/
./configure #Opcional en caso de ser necesario u error: --enable-optimizations
make -j2 #Reemplace el número por otro para indicar la cantidad de núcleos de CPU asignados a la tarea.
sudo make install #Preferiblemente con el parámetro altinstall para una instalación en paralelo.

Om allt har gått bra fram till denna punkt, det vill säga den nedladdade versionen har kompilerats framgångsrikt, återstår bara prova att installera den nya versionen och installation och användning av Python-paket via "pip"-hanteraren. Vilket kan göras med hjälp av följande kommandoorder:

python3.13 --version #Para chequear la versión nueva instalada.
python3 --version #Para chequear la versión previa instalada.
python3 -m pip --version #Para chequear la versión actual del Gestor PIP en la versión previa instalada de Python.
python3.13 -m pip --version #Para chequear la versión actual del Gestor PIP en la nueva versión instalada de Python.
python3.13 -m pip install --upgrade pip setuptools wheel #Instalación y actualización de paquetes Python esenciales.
sudo pip3.13 install --upgrade pip #Actualización a la última versión disponible del Gestor PIP.
sudo pip3.13 install speedtest-cli #Instalación del paquete Python SpeedTest CLI instalado con el Gestor PIP.
speedtest-cli #Ejecución del paquete Python SpeedTest CLI instalado con el Gestor PIP.
pyenv
Relaterad artikel:
Pyenv: Installera flera versioner av Python på ditt system

Sammanfattning 2023 - 2024

Sammanfattning

Kort sagt, om du är en av dem tekniska, medelstora eller avancerade användare (Dev, DevOps, SysAdmin, HelpDesk) eller helt enkelt en nyfiken självlärd teknolog av fria och öppna tekniker år 2024, vi hoppas att denna praktiska och användbara handledning om hur «installera en ny version av Python på Ubuntu och Debian » låter dig lösa alla krav oavsett om det är en gammal och stabil version eller en modern och utvecklande version. Dessutom, om du känner till någon annan mer effektiv alternativ metod, inbjuder vi dig att nämna det och kortfattat förklara det i kommentarerna för att studera, testa och njuta av hela vår Linuxera IT-gemenskap.

Slutligen, kom ihåg att dela detta användbara och roliga inlägg med andra, och besök början av vår «plats» på spanska eller andra språk (lägga till 2 bokstäver i slutet av webbadressen, till exempel: ar, de, en, fr, ja, pt och ru, bland många andra). Dessutom inbjuder vi dig att gå med i vår Officiell Telegram-kanal för att läsa och dela fler nyheter, guider och tutorials från vår webbplats. Och även nästa Alternativ Telegram-kanal för att lära dig mer om Linuxverse i allmänhet.


Lämna din kommentar

Din e-postadress kommer inte att publiceras. Obligatoriska fält är markerade med *

*

*

  1. Ansvarig för uppgifterna: Miguel Ángel Gatón
  2. Syftet med uppgifterna: Kontrollera skräppost, kommentarhantering.
  3. Legitimering: Ditt samtycke
  4. Kommunikation av uppgifterna: Uppgifterna kommer inte att kommuniceras till tredje part förutom enligt laglig skyldighet.
  5. Datalagring: databas värd för Occentus Networks (EU)
  6. Rättigheter: När som helst kan du begränsa, återställa och radera din information.